'Pinhead' is the name given to a set of exercises designed to use a consistent base model to practice short-form sculpts created in a single sitting of no longer than 4 hours. As the base is already created, the focus is entirely on the sculpting without worrying about any of the annoying little bits of working digitally.
The Pinhead Project is designed to be a workshop for the advanced sculptor who wishes to improve his/her craft through critiques, comments, and moderated workshops along with other sculptors of a similar skill set.
It IS a place where everyone starts with the same base and in the same time to compare the products of their work and improve both in skill and in efficiency.
It IS a place that is meant to show work and get feedback, given that it is done within the guidelines of the board.
It is NOT a place for the novice sculptor to learn step-by-step of how to create sculpts in digital 3d.
It is NOT required that you use any particular software (though there are base meshes in ZTL format for download).
With the focus on Pinheads, that is, short-form sculpting in a single sitting from a consistent base model, there really is no way to cheat skill.
